Hi everybody, I found this PAT. D Coca Cola bottle in a dump about a year ago. It is perfectly flawless. There are no chips, pits, or scratches on it at all. It has "Louisville, KY" on the bottom of it. Does anyone know how much this bottle might be worth ? Any info would be greatly appreciated. Thanks--Justin

Hi not a lot, maybe if some happen to be from that town, that's about it. A contour bottle can only be worth something if it is a pat 1915 or pat 1923 then it what town it's from whould determine the price.

A friend of mine who just returned from the Reno Bottle show told me they where selling for about $5. I have about a 12 of them from the 40's and 50's
